Cultivating Arctic Landscapes : Knowing and Managing Animals in the Circumpolar North
Authors: ---
ISBN: 1782382097 Year: 2004 Publisher: New York, NY : Berghahn Books,

Loading...
Export citation

Choose an application

Bookmark

Abstract

In the last two decades, there has been an increased awareness of the traditions and issues that link aboriginal people across the circumpolar North. One of the key aspects of the lives of circumpolar peoples, be they in Scandinavia, Alaska, Russia, or Canada, is their relationship to the wild animals that support them. Although divided for most of the 20th Century by various national trading blocks, and the Cold War, aboriginal people in each region share common stories about the various capitalist and socialist states that claimed control over their lands and animals.
